Cost-Effectiveness: Contrasting the Monetary Elements of Oral Implants and Dentures



If you're considering dental implants or dentures, you may be asking yourself which alternative is extra cost-efficient. When over here involves set you back, it is very important to think about both the preliminary financial investment and the lasting expenses.

Dental implants have a tendency to have a higher upfront expense contrasted to dentures. This is due to the fact that the procedure of dental implant placement involves surgery and using high-quality products. Nevertheless, it's worth noting that dental implants are designed to be a long-lasting solution. They're more long lasting and can last a life time with appropriate treatment, reducing the need for constant replacements or fixings.

On the other hand, dentures might have a reduced preliminary price, but they might call for changes, relining, or perhaps substitute gradually, which can build up in terms of recurring costs.

Ultimately, the cost-effectiveness of dental implants versus dentures depends upon your specific needs and choices, in addition to your long-term dental health and wellness goals.

Durability: Recognizing the Durability and Life Expectancy of Oral Implants and Dentures



Consider the long life and lifespan of oral implants and dentures when making a decision which alternative is right for you. Both oral implants and dentures have their own longevity and lifespan, and it is very important to understand these factors before making a decision.

Here are 4 bottom lines to consider:

1. Implants: Dental implants are made to be a permanent solution for missing teeth. With correct care and upkeep, they can last a life time. This is because implants are operatively put in the jawbone, giving a stable foundation for man-made teeth.

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are removable appliances that change missing teeth. While they can be an affordable choice, they generally have a shorter life-span compared to implants. Dentures might require to be changed every 5-7 years because of damage.

3. Maintenance: Oral implants need routine brushing, flossing, and oral exams, much like all-natural teeth. Dentures need daily cleansing and soaking to stop microorganisms accumulation.

4. Bone Health: Oral implants boost the jawbone, protecting against bone loss and preserving facial structure. Dentures, nonetheless, don't supply the very same degree of stimulation, which can bring about bone loss gradually.

Recognizing the sturdiness and lifespan of dental implants and dentures is essential in making a notified choice. Seek advice from your dental expert to establish which option is ideal suited for your certain requirements and conditions.

Oral Health Conveniences: Evaluating the Impact of Oral Implants and Dentures on General Oral Health And Wellness



Maintaining correct dental health is critical in evaluating the influence of oral implants and dentures on your total dental wellness.



Dental implants provide significant oral health advantages as they operate like natural teeth, boosting the jawbone and avoiding bone loss. This aids in preserving the structure and stability of your jaw, which in turn sustains your face attributes.

With oral implants, you can take pleasure in a more all-natural biting and chewing experience, permitting you to consume a larger range of foods conveniently. Additionally, oral implants don't require any unique cleansing strategies; you can merely comb and floss them like your all-nat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ures call for special treatment and cleaning, as they require to be eliminated and cleaned up independently. Dentures can likewise cause gum irritation and discomfort if not properly fitted.
